Rockwell Automation completes acquisition of Clearpath Robotics and Otto Motors

October 11, 2023 by David Edwards

Rockwell Automation, which says it is “the world’s largest company dedicated to industrial automation and digital transformation”, has completed its acquisition of Ontario, Canada-based Clearpath Robotics, a developer of autonomous robotics, including autonomous mobile robots for industrial applications.

The acquisition includes Clearpath Robotics’ namesake research division, a developer autonomous technology for the innovation market, and the industrial division Otto Motors, which provides AMRs, which Rockwell says is “the next frontier in industrial automation and transformation”.

Both divisions will report to Rockwell’s Intelligent Devices operating segment. Financial details do not appear to have been officially disclosed, but media reports say Rockwell may be paying $600 million for the acquisition. Emerson acquires Afag to accelerate factory automation capabilities

October 11, 2023 by Mark Allinson

Emerson has acquired Afag Holding AG, an innovator in electric linear motion, feeding and handling automation solutions.

The electric linear motion segment expands Emerson’s served market by more than $9 billion and is expected to grow mid-single digits annually, supporting Emerson’s long-term, profitable organic growth.

Afag, headquartered in Zell, Switzerland, brings state-of-the-art technology and innovation to Emerson. The acquisition enhances Emerson’s capabilities in factory automation and creates a leading motion portfolio that combines Afag’s electric linear motion solutions with Emerson’s pneumatic motion technology. Neura Robotics secures $16 million from InterAlpen Partners

October 10, 2023 by Mark Allinson

Neura Robotics, an emerging AI and robotics startup based in Germany, has closed a $16 million investment round with American private equity firm InterAlpen Partners.

This comes less than three months after the German company closed a $55 million funding round with leading European investors, garnering recognition from the New York Stock Exchange. InterAlpen’s investment in Neura will bolster its growth and expansion into the US market.

IAR Group strengthens market position through acquisition of Sontec

October 10, 2023 by Mark Allinson

IAR Group from Zofingen (Switzerland), which specializes in automation systems, is taking over Sontec AG from Hochdorf (Switzerland), which is active in the fields of automated testing technology, assembly automation, robotics and image processing, with immediate effect.

With this acquisition, the IAR Group strengthens its position in the global market for industrial automation and increases its production capacity in Switzerland.
